Two drastically different people meet through an essay about the single life and revisit their old wounds from past loves in the process. Park Young Ho is a popular lecturer and influencer with 300,000 followers. He thoroughly enjoys the single life and lives teetering between being emotional and being pretentious. Joo Hyun Jin, a college junior of Young Ho’s, is a competent publisher and the editor-in-chief in charge of the essay series titled “Single in the City.” She dislikes being alone. Presumptions & Perceptions

This movie is an essay on presumption and perception.
Every scene explores how different people interpret the same things based on how their life experiences have shaped their point of view. From the editor's notes to the male writer, to the editor's "romantic life," and the conflict about a couple's first love story.

Beautifully shot scenes, excellent acting, and a story that challenges the viewers presumptions and perceptions.

I was super excited for this movie because of Lee Dong Wook and what I thought I would be seeing, and I ended up seeing more than I expected.
